понедельник, 9 июля 2007 г.

эмуляционный уикенд

Все выходные, исключая святое время на поесть/поспать/погулять и пару часов на какой нить филм, пытался погружаться в детство, не вылазя из пингвиньей шкуры. Говоря же нормальным русским, баловался со сборкой известного в широких никс-кругах Wine'a от комании Etersoft, а точнее говоря, с паблик-версией оной, ибо за "приват" (или как оно там на самом деле называется) компиляцию ребята просят уже сколько-то всемирного эквивалента. Вообще говоря, сборка Wine@Etersoft предназначена для запуска в nix-окружении таких win-ориентированных софтин, как 1С со всеми составляющими и прочей офисной шелупони. Точный список не уточнял ;). Похожим же занимаются ребята из Codeweavers, извесные продуктом Crossover Office, предназначенного, как видно из названия, для пакета MS Office разных лет и еще добрых пары десятков софтин, красивых и разных, список которых (а именно тех, что "полюбому" должны встать и запуститься) есть в самой программе. Если интересно, поставите - увидите. Однако помимо всего вышесказанного, етерсофтовская приблуда, как оказалось, оооооочень неплохо справляется с запуском win-платформенных игр. Правда сказать, инсталлятор эмулируется хреновенько, поэтому установить игру из имеющегося дистриба - задача далеко не тривиальная (мне из всего перепробованного удалось провести сей фокус только с FIFA07), так что выбор игрушек ограничивается теми, что запускаются, будучи где-то и когда-то уже установленными. И естественно, без защиты. Теоретически защищенные или просто требующие наличия CD/DVD игры (пусть даже в iso/mdf формате) дОлжно бы устанавливать и запускать через еще одну эмуляционно-геймерскую приблуду - Cedega от TransGaming... Должно... но что то у меня не вышло - непосредственно образы она глотать не хочет (вернее, я не нашел куда их ей скормить), а физических компакт дисков не имею, к сожалению (или к счастью ;) ). Что-то запускать получалось, что-то нет. Вывод могу сделать один - все это еще очень нестабильно, непрогнозируемо и нехило зависит от фазы луны. Запустится или нет - как повезет. Однако если не вышло что-то запустить, прежде чем с матами удалять очередной game-шедевр, советую почитать вывод эмулятора в консоли. Очень часто оказывается, что игрушке не хватает одной двух библиотек, о чем она честно и вещает в логе. Берем их где угодно (я, к примеру, топал на dll-files.com), кидаем в ~/wine_c/windows/system, и пробуем снова - пару раз ужалось вытащить на свет божий желанную игрушку. А иногда нет... как повезет, я уже говорил. Да, все еще остра и актуальна проблема совместного сосушествования игровой индустрии и linux... По пальцам можно подсчитать проекты, нативно запускающиеся в сей среде. Wine и его коммерческие форки развиваются, совершенствуются с каждым днем, однако до триумфа на десктопе типичного даже не геймера, а юзверя им, а следовательно и Linux в целом - еще очень долгий путь предстоит пройти. Удачи же вам...большой и толстой!

Комментариев нет:

][a-][a c башорга